ENGINE OIL LEVEL SENSOR INSPECTION [WITHOUT CYLINDER DEACTIVATION (SKYACTIV-G 2.0, SKYACTIV-G 2.5)]
id0140m1538000
With Engine Oil Level Sensor
PID/DATA monitor inspection
1. Verify that there is no engine oil leakage.
2. Inspect the engine oil level. (See ENGINE OIL LEVEL INSPECTION [WITHOUT CYLINDER DEACTIVATION (SKYACTIV-G 2.0, SKYACTIV-G 2.5)].)
3. Connect the M-MDS to the DLC-2.
4. Switch the ignition ON (engine off).
5. Access the PID/DATA monitor item EOL using the M-MDS. (See ON-BOARD DIAGNOSTIC TEST [PCM (WITHOUT CYLINDER DEACTIVATION (SKYACTIV-G 2.0, SKYACTIV-G 2.5))].)
6. Verify that the PID EOL value and the engine oil amount measured using the dipstick are same.
